FV = P x (1 + r)^t for nominal value, and FV = P x ((1 + r)/(1 + inflation))^t for real (inflation-adjusted) value.
The projected worth of money you have today, assuming it grows at a set rate. A dollar today is worth more than a dollar in five years — future value makes that growth explicit.
Because a $40,000 nest egg in 15 years buys less than $40,000 today. If your return merely matches inflation, your real value is flat no matter how large the nominal number gets.
